Output efccf46413e726a30de37b1acdeeedd4e8e46a0d75a86ba164ef0d4aa74fea87:2

value
181220229
script pubkey
OP_HASH160 OP_PUSHBYTES_20 036d5345d0ca896ae143b7a6e1107f69aaf07dd8 OP_EQUAL
address
M8DHE4Qh16Y1wTexLMrmRojFe42oMjW1Fg
transaction
efccf46413e726a30de37b1acdeeedd4e8e46a0d75a86ba164ef0d4aa74fea87
spent
true